The single cast-on method (also known as the backwards loop or e-loop method) is one that's popular amongst beginner knitters. Instead of going through the stitch, like in regular knitting, you cast on stitches by inserting the needle between stitches.This creates a much more stable edge which is why this method is ideal for places where you need stability, not flexibility — such as buttonholes. There are many different methods for casting-on in knitting, but the knit cast-on is perfect for beginners because you learn how to form knit stitches as you add the stitches to the needle.This makes the learning process go a bit faster.
